ZapSplat is a website that offers more than 20,000 sound effects and songs that you can download and re-use for free. The licensing that ZapSplat uses is quite clear. As long as you cite ZapSplat, you can use the sound effects and music in your videos, podcasts, and other multimedia projects.
ZapSplat does require you to create an account in order to download the MP3 and WAV files that it hosts. Once you have created an account you can download as many files as you like. ZapSplat does offer a "Gold" account. The benefit of a Gold account is that you don't have to cite ZapSplat and access to an expanded library of sounds.
Applications for Education
ZapSplat could be a good resource to bookmark for the next time your students need a sound effect to use in a video or podcast. On ZapSplat they'll find typical sounds like a doorbell ringing and a dog barking. ZapSplat also provides some unique sound effects and recordings like a pilot speaking to passengers and alien creatures eating.

Download Sound Effects from Sound Clips
SoundCli.ps is a gallery of free sounds that I just learned about from Stephen Ransom. SoundCli.ps is a community-powered site on which you can upload sounds to share and download sounds shared by others. I was able to download sounds without registering on the site. To upload sounds you do need to register on the site. The video below gives a short overview of the site.
Applications for Education
If you're looking for a new source of sounds that your students can use for their multimedia projects, SoundCli.ps might just be what you're looking for. Remind students that they should credit the source of the sounds that they download and use in their projects.

Free Music from Moby for Amateur Filmmakers
I don't particularly care for Moby's music (hear a sample here), but if you or your students like Moby, he's got a present for you. Through Moby Gratis you can download more than one hundred songs and sounds for use in your video creation projects. The music is available to amateur filmmakers as long as you adhere to the simple use guidelines. To access the music you do have to register for a free account on Moby Gratis.
Applications for Education
Finding free music and sounds that are appropriate for a video project can be a challenge sometimes. Moby Gratis is a source of music that you can add to your list along with the sources in this list and this list that I've previously published.

The Art of Movie Sounds
A key element in most good movies is the soundtrack of that movie. There is more to a sound track than a compilation of songs. The sounds of horses galloping, a crowd cheering, or the bustle of a busy subway are also sound elements that can become part of what makes a movie great. The people that create those sounds are called foley artists. In the video below foley artist Gary Hecker demonstrates and explains the creation of many sounds heard in movies.

Free Sound Effects Library
Free SFX is a provider of free, royalty-free sound effect loops. The catalog of free sound effects can be browsed by genre or searched by keyword tag. Once you have registered for a free account you can begin downloading any of the free sound effect loops. One thing to take note of is Free SFX does mix in some “premium” results. Premium sound effects are not free to download.
Applications for Education
Free SFX could be a good resource for locating sounds that your students can use in podcasts, videos, and other multimedia productions.
